London, Feb 11 : Titus Bramble, who has been accused of sexually assaulting two women, denied the claims when he appeared in court on Friday.
The 30-year-old Sunderland defender is accused of indecently touching two women in separate incidents during a night out.
Bramble, who is from Wynyard near Middlesbrough, appeared at Teesside Crown Court for a plea and directions hearing.
He faces four charges relating to the alleged incidents in Yarm, Teesside, on September 28 last year, the Sun reported.
They are - indecently touching one alleged victim, allegedly touching another woman's leg and moving his hands towards her crotch without consent and twice placing her hand on his crotch. (ANI)
